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
66544 105 24966 966
572070607 4076485
572070607 4076485
28975289 8514774 564559 3910893 61
All about undefined
Interested in learning more?
572070607 4076485
28975289 8514774 564559 3910893 61
See more
60 83783391646
716572571 28431191 9876
See more
9872 91715326016 319889
02160 6777650 5209633 60
See more